Description

It monitors the CPU Usage Per Txn, Database CPU Time Ratio, Database Wait Time Ratio, Executions Per Sec, Executions Per Txn, User Transaction Per Sec, Response Time Per Txn, Sql Service Response Time, and it works for Oracle 11g database version onwards. It is applicable on all the on-premise Oracle databases.

Prerequisites

The database you want to monitor should connect from the Gateway. Gateway Management profile should be added to the device. Database type credentials should be added against the device in the portal. While applying the template, the database port, SID or Service Name, connection timeout need to be specified.

Metric Parameters

Metric Parameters
ParameterDescription
Frequency
  • Frequency is the interval in which you want to probe and collect metric data from the target device/resource
  • Frequency is defined in minutes (min).
  • Warning ThresholdIf the metric value satisfies the condition defined along with Warning Threshold value, then a notification is sent to the user.
    Critical ThresholdIf the metric value satisfies the condition defined along with Critical Threshold value, then a notification is sent to the user.
    AlertThe alert value can be set to either Yes or No. If it is Yes, then an alert message is sent to the user.

    Metrics

    oracle.cpu.usage.per.sec

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This metric represents the CPU usage per second by the database processes, measured in hundredths of a second.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.cpu.usage.per.txn

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e amount of CPU usage per transaction for the specific task or session.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.database.cpu.time.ratio

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e Database CPU Time Ratio is of limited value as a tuning tool. The Database CPU Time Ratio is computed by dividing the amount of CPU used in the database by the amount of total database time. Total database time is the time spent by the database on user-level calls.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.executions.per.txn

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e average amount of time per execution
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.executions.per.sec

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e average transactions per second
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.sql.service.response.time

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ionSQL Response Time is the average elapsed time per execution of a representative set of SQL statements, relative to a baseline.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    Unitms

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.user.transaction.per.sec

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e User Commits Per Sec Oracle metric data item represents the number of user commits performed, per second during the sample period.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.response.time.per.txn

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ionThe Response Time Per Txn Oracle metric is using only statistics available within the database, this data item gives the best approximation of response time, in seconds, per transaction during this sample period.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ph

    oracle.database.wait.time.ratio

    Metric Details

    Metric Details
    Applicable forDevice
    DescriptionIt monitors database wait time ratio.
    CategoryApplication
    Collector TypeGateway
    Monitor NameOracle System Summary
    UnitNULL

    Possible Inputs

    Possible Inputs
    MetricInput ValueRange of Values
    Frequency51 – 1440 (mins)
    Filter
    Warning Operator
    Warning Threshold
    Warning Repeat Count
    Critical Operator
    Critical Threshold
    Critical Repeat Count
    AlertNoYes/No
    Graph (Yes/No)YesYes/No

    Sample Output

    No graph